Abstract

Introduction: Diseases of the aorta are classified into acute aortic syndromes and aortic aneurysms. The overall mortality rate is 2.49 per 100,000 population for aortic dissection (AD) and aortic aneurysm (AA). Both conditions are associated with increased arterial pressure and/or abnormalities of the medial layer.

 

Materials and Methods: This is a descriptive, observational study on mortality analysis of AD and AA in Chile between 2018 and 2022, based on age group, sex, subclassification, and mortality rate (MR). Data were obtained from the Department of Statistics and Health Information. No ethics committee approval was required.

 

Results: A total of 2,412 deaths were analyzed, with 62.1% being males. 41.2% of the deaths occurred in the age group of 65-79 years, and 42.03% corresponded to the subclassification of AD (any part). The Metropolitan region accounted for 42.12% of the fatalities. The overall mortality rate for the period was 2.74.

 

Discussion: The number of deaths showed a slight decrease during the COVID-19 pandemic years of 2020-2021, which is not consistent with the findings reported in the international literature, specifically a report from the United Kingdom. During this period, there were confinement measures, strain on the healthcare system, and increased perception of risk among the population when seeking medical care. The findings regarding sex and age group align with the literature, with males and the 65-79 age group having the highest number of deaths. This population group has a higher prevalence of comorbidities such as hypertension and atherosclerosis. The MR during the study period maintained a stable trend around the average, except for the years 2020 and 2021, where there was a slight decrease, which coincides with the international literature.
